Calling via Teams App

  1. Open the Teams app on your desktop or mobile device.
    • Sign in to your UTD credentials if you’re not already. 
  2. Select Calls in the Teams app located on the left-hand side of the screen

Teams Calls Feature highlighting the Calls Icon in the Menu

  1. Click on the Dial Pad icon.
  2. Dial the Country code > enter the International phone number
    • If you are unsure about the country code for the country you are calling, use an online resource or directory to look up the correct country code. 

Teams Calls Feature highlighting the Call Button

  1. Click on the Call button to initiate the call. 

  1. Ensure your Poly desk phone is set up and connected to your Microsoft Teams account
  2. From the home screen of your desk phone, tap on the Call icon. 

Picture of Home screen on desk phone with call bottom towards bottom left.

  1. Tap on the Dialpad icon on the bottom right

Dial pad button located on desk phone screen towards bottom right

  1. Dial the Country code (press and hold 0 to enter the + Plus sign icon) and enter the International phone number.
    • As soon as you enter the number, it will automatically call. You can also tap on the Call button.
